Comparative genomic analysis reveals reduced pathogenicity of <i>Ralstonia</i> spp. in water

2024-10-24

Abstract excerpt

Ralstonia spp., known for their adaptability across various habitats, are known to cause infections. The adaptive metabolic diversity of those inhabiting aquatic ecosystems remains poorly understood. We report four new Ralstonia pickettii genomes enriched in the cyanobacterial culture derived from bloom-forming cyanobacteria, Dolichospermum .
